Cannabis use disorder may increase risk of COVID-19 hospitalization

Researchers in the United States have conducted a study suggesting that genetic vulnerability to a psychiatric syndrome called cannabis use disorder (CUD) may increase the risk of developing severe co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) that requires hospitalization. Zenabis Touts 61% Increase In Cannabis Revenue In Q3

Canadian cannabis company Zenabis Global Inc. reported Friday that its net revenue amounted to CA$19 million in the third quarter. That’s a sequential increase of 61%. Zenabis CEO Shai Altman credited the revenue growth to Cannabis 2.0 products, which the company launched during the quarter.
